Many people who are in debt or are having a hard time paying their bills, and because of their higher income, and because they think they may not qualify for a Chapter 7 Bankruptcy, might also want to explore the possibility of a Chapter 13 Bankruptcy.   Although you might not be able to erase the debt 100% as you can in a Chapter 7, in a Chapter 13 you would be able to package the debt and pay it back over 5 years at 0% interest up to an amount you can afford to pay.  This could result in a monthly payment substantially less than you are paying now.  Feel free to contact Attorney Mark O.
